Trail Overview
This trail is an easy dirt road to the cemetery coming from the east side. Once you are past the cemetery at mile 0.7, the trail gets more difficult with ruts, washouts, overgrown brush, a rocky creek crossing, and tight trees. On the east side, there is a Mulberry River access point with a gravel lot and a bathroom. If you are using the trail for the river access, you can use the east entrance. If you are using the trail for trailing, you can use the west entrance.

Difficulty
The east end of the trail is easy for any vehicle to use. The west end of the trail is the more difficult end of the trail. The trail has some washouts, ruts, overgrown brush, tight trees, and a rocky creek crossing.
